This Digital Marketing Manager role is positioned in a leading law firm, coming in on a 14-month fixed term contract. In this role you will focus on enhancing the firm’s reputation, building strategic relationships, and ultimately, contributing to revenue growth within the firms’ core sectors (Technology, Life Sciences, Private Wealth, and Real Estate) and practices (Corporate, Disputes, and IP).

Your Key Responsibilities:

  • Strategic Digital Development: Craft and execute comprehensive digital marketing strategies to boost brand profile, website traffic, and user engagement across all online platforms.
  • Digital Scope & Innovation: Analyse business drivers, gather technical requirements, and collaborate with fee earners and PSLs to identify opportunities for new web/app content and functionality.
  • Team Leadership & Management: Oversee the digital team (including three UK-based Digital Executives) and an external digital agency, ensuring high-quality output and adherence to service level agreements.
  • Platform Optimisation: Continuously review and improve our digital estate (website, social media, paid media, newsletters) for usability, readability, and best practices.
  • Reach & Engagement: Advise on strategies to maximize reach through SEO, paid search, social media, display ads, and third-party media.
  • Social Media Expertise: Guide the firm on best practice social media behavior and expectations, providing tools and guidance to facilitate engagement.
  • International Collaboration: Liaise with international jurisdictions to ensure optimal utilization of digital platforms and social channels.
  • Performance Analysis & Reporting: Track and measure online performance against KPIs, providing monthly insights and reports.

The successful candidate for the role will have proven digital marketing experience within a legal and/or professional services environment.
